Planning appeal decision

Dismissed10 January 20223277643

Hill End House, Millers Lane, Lidlington, BEDFORD, MK43 0SN

Single storey rear extension and front extension, glazing and dormers to main house, dormer to outbuilding and conversion of outbuilding to annexe

Authority
Central Bedfordshire
Appeal type
householder · Householder (HAS)
Procedure
Written Representations
Development
residential · Householder developments
Inspector
Plenty B

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• The effect of the proposed development on the character and appearance of the area
  • The effect of the proposal on the living conditions of the occupiers of Hillside with particular regard to privacy

What decided it

The proposed development would harm the character and appearance of the area through its discordant design, poor relationship to the existing dwelling, and likely loss of a protected tree, conflicting with the development plan with no material considerations to outweigh this harm.

Plan policies cited: Policy HQ1, Policy T3, Policy CS14, Policy DM3
